听力原文: Some children wish to be writers some day, They mean that they want to write stories or books which many persons will read. I would like to remind them that they will need to be good readers and to read a great deal in order to be good writers.
Nearly all great writers were read too long before they started to school, and have been reading for hours and hours every day since they became good readers. Instead of watching TV in the evening, they spend much of their spare time reading books.
If you are a good reader, it won't take you long to do the reading homework your teacher asks you to do. Then you will have time to read other books for fun. Because you read so well, you keep looking for more books to read.
While making up your mind to become a good writer, you had better say to yourself. "I must read more and more if I am really to become a good writer."
